The BL-D50A is manufactured by Okuma as part of their BL Drive Series. It features a continuous current of 7.5 A and a 15 A peak current. The BL-D50A also features a 150 V DC Bus voltage and a AC input voltage of 107 V

Product Description

Okuma is famous for its quality products like industrial brushless servo motors, brushless AC servo drives, and controllers. The company also develops a wide range of CNC control modules.

The BL-D50A model is designed and manufactured by Okuma and it assists in developing an energy-efficient motion control system. The BL brushless servo drive can be mounted or installed in the rack with sufficient room at the top and bottom of the module for heat loss. The drive uses natural air to maintain its ambient temperature (0 to +60 degree Celsius) and it must be installed at the altitude prescribed in the user manual. The model has low-loss PWM frequency and is extensively used to monitor and control the functions of the Digiplan brushless servo motor. The motor takes electrical power through the U, V, and W terminals of the drive, and the DC (-) and DC (+) terminals are used to take the input power of 24 – 48 VDC. The servo drive takes input power from the transformer and the transformer is further connected to the main AC voltage line. The BL brushless servo drive comes with built-in incremental encoder feedback that assists in controlling the speed and position of the attached servo motor.

The brushless servo drive communicates via a 4-bit absolute encoder. Several LEDs are available at the front and rear sides of the servo drive to show the status of different parameters of the drive. The model BL-D50A is fully protected against overtemperature and overvoltage. A pre-installation test should be conducted through a temporary bench-top configuration. BL-D50A Technical Specifications

AC Input Voltage Nominal: 107 V
Continuous Current: 7.5 A
DC Bus Voltage : 150 V
Peak Current: 15 A
